Henri de Juvenel was a French writer and the husband of the renowned author Colette. He is known for his association with the historic Château de Castel Novel, where he lived and inspired some of Colette's literary works. The château has a rich history, dating back to the 13th century, and was owned by the de Juvenel family for a significant period.
